Introduction to Auttiköngäs

Auttiköngäs is located in the municipality of Rovaniemi, in Finnish Lapland, in the heart of a forested landscape shaped by water and rugged terrain. The site is known as a natural attraction and a viewpoint, in an area where the Auttijoki River has carved its way through the scenery.

The place belongs to a nature reserve valued for its wild setting and more uneven topography than the surrounding forests. Auttiköngäs is associated with a rocky gorge and open views over the valley, making it a notable spot to observe the local geography around Rovaniemi.

The address Auttikönkääntie 119 marks the access point to this nature area southeast of Rovaniemi. The site appeals for the combination of river, wooded slopes and rock formations, which create a landscape typical of Lapland nature, both peaceful and visually striking.

At Auttiköngäs, the interest comes as much from the terrain as from the atmosphere of a nature reserve. The site reveals the effects of water on rock and forest, in an environment where the viewpoint makes sense through the presence of the gorge, the watercourse and the tree-covered slopes.
